Can i use ajax powder to wash clothes?

Can i use ajax powder to wash clothes? There’s actually several things you should not wash with Ajax® Ultra. It’s not supposed to be used on carpet and rug stains. And please, never think about using it for bathing or shampooing. Also, don’t use it as a replacement for Laundry Detergent.

What can you clean with Ajax powder? It wipes down appliances, marble and granite. You can also use it to clean stainless steel appliances, blinds, bathroom/shower, walls, floors and even patio furniture!

Can you use Comet powder in laundry? No. The particles in that powdered cleanser don’t dissolve they will damage your washing machine and the drain pipes. Don’t do it.

What can I use if I run out of laundry detergent? “In the absence of laundry detergents, bar soap, liquid hand soap, body wash, and dish soap can be used for hand laundering,” says Dr. Pete He, co-founder and chief scientist of Dirty Labs.

How do you make baking powder?

To make baking powder, mix one part baking soda and two parts cream of tartar. So, if you recipe calls for 1 tablespoon of baking powder, use 1 teaspoon of baking soda, mixed in with 2 teaspoons of cream of tartar.

What does baking powder do for biscuits?

The tiny bubbles of carbon dioxide create lightness in the dough, which makes goodies like biscuits rise and gives them a fluffy crumb. Another by-product of the same reaction creates sodium carbonate, which tastes unpleasantly alkaline.

Where do snails come from in the garden?

Weeds, piles of dead plants and even compost piles provide attractive nesting sites for snails. Pulling weeds, especially those with tender foliage, from around the garden bed and removing all dead plant material from the garden promptly makes your garden less attractive to snails.
